Get started16 West Bank is a mid-terrace house in Bradford (BD9 4BL). It has a recorded floor area of 175 m² (around 1884 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(July 2022) shows a D (score 64),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in April 2022 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Good and lighting went from Very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 80).
Untraded for 19 years, with the last transfer in January 2007. That sale landed at the peak of the pre-credit-crunch market, which is a useful reference point when interpreting the price. Today's modelled estimate of £188,000 is 29.7% above the 2007 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£77/sq ft) was about 26.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
